Ever since I started subscribing to RSS feeds I’ve been trying out new feed readers whether they be desktop or web-based ones, never staying with one for very long (by the way, I’m currently using the fantastic NewsHutch which I’ll be reviewing shortly). When Google first released Google Reader, I wasn’t very impressed, but with the recent updates, I can say Reader is finally useful.

First off there’s a new design which makes it easier to read feeds. Additionally, there are now two different views available. You can read your feeds in expanded view like nearly any other reader or view them in list view which looks very similar to your GMail inbox, expect when you click on a title, the full article expands without a refresh.
